Haifeng Lu is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ering and Aerospace Engineering. According to data from OpenAlex, Haifeng Lu has authored 45 papers receiving a total of 619 indexed citations (citations by other indexed papers that have themselves been cited), including 42 papers in Electrical and Electronic Engineering, 10 papers in Control and Systems Engineering and 3 papers in Aerospace Engineering. Recurrent topics in Haifeng Lu's work include Multilevel Inverters and Converters (27 papers), Electric Motor Design and Analysis (21 papers) and Sensorless Control of Electric Motors (21 papers). Haifeng Lu is often cited by papers focused on Multilevel Inverters and Converters (27 papers), Electric Motor Design and Analysis (21 papers) and Sensorless Control of Electric Motors (21 papers). Haifeng Lu collaborates with scholars based in China, Taiwan and United States. Haifeng Lu's co-authors include Wenlong Qu, Lei Zhang, Jianyun Chai, Xiaomeng Cheng, Yongdong Li, Fan Yang, Xudong Sun, Xing Zhang, Fred Wang and Leon M. Tolbert and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Transactions on Power Electronics and Optics Letters.
